Valuable Physical Collectible Coins
Highly valuable collectible coins with historical significance and rarity include:
- 1933 Double Eagle: One of the rarest gold coins, valued around $18.9 million.
- Brasher Doubloon (1787): One of the earliest American gold coins, valued about $9.36 million.
- Half Eagle (1822): Very few known, valued around $8.4 million.
- 1804 Silver Dollar: Known as the "King of U.S. Coins," valued about $7.68 million.
- Saint-Gaudens Double Eagle (1907) Ultra High Relief: Highly rare, valued around $7.2 million.
- Umayyad Gold Dinar (723 AD): Early Islamic gold coin, valued about $6 million.
- Other rare coins with significant value include the 1870 Three-Dollar Piece and various rare 50p coins from the UK.
These coins are valuable due to extreme rarity, historical importance, or unique features.
